This is another stint into OpenGL, but using C++ instead of Lisp on Windows.
This repo assumes a Windows 10/11 OS on 64 bit. I don't want to use Visual Studio, or its build tools, so I'll be utilizing MinGW's gcc/g++ (MinGW-64).

cd libs-and-headers
git clone [email protected]:glfw/glfw
cd glfw
git checkout 3.3.9
cmake -S . -B build -G "Unix Makefiles"
cd build
make
cd ../../../
mkdir lib/gcc
cp -r libs-and-headers/glfw/build/src/libglfw3.a lib/gcc

Version: 3.3.9 (WIN64)
Go to GLFW's download page and grab the binaries for 64-bit Windows. Or whatever is appropriate for your system.
Unzip this wherever you like, take the contents and place them in the libs-and-headers
directory. If you unzipped directly into libs-and-headers
, and you get a crazy name like glfw-3.3.9.bin.WIN64
, rename it to glfw
(or don't, it's up to you).
Put everyting in glfw's
include/
dir into the project root's include/
dir, and put the appropriate compiler lib folder into the project root's lib/
dir.
